一種稀疏恢復(fù)的穩(wěn)健配準(zhǔn)補(bǔ)償方法

【摘要】:常規(guī)基于配準(zhǔn)補(bǔ)償方法因子孔徑損失和先驗(yàn)信息失配問(wèn)題,導(dǎo)致雜波距離依賴(lài)性和補(bǔ)償性能下降.為解決上述問(wèn)題,將稀疏恢復(fù)算法引入到雜波距離依賴(lài)性補(bǔ)償當(dāng)中,并對(duì)常規(guī)基于配準(zhǔn)補(bǔ)償方法中各距離單元回波數(shù)據(jù)預(yù)處理過(guò)程加以改進(jìn),提出了一種基于稀疏恢復(fù)的穩(wěn)健距離配準(zhǔn)補(bǔ)償方法——SRBC方法.該方法與常規(guī)基于配準(zhǔn)補(bǔ)償方法相比,無(wú)需子孔徑平滑,不依賴(lài)于先驗(yàn)知識(shí),直接利用稀疏恢復(fù)得到超分辨的雜波空時(shí)譜,計(jì)算得出過(guò)渡協(xié)方差矩陣,再通過(guò)Capon譜重構(gòu)出雜波協(xié)方差矩陣.經(jīng)仿真驗(yàn)證,SRBC方法不受先驗(yàn)信息失配影響,不僅能夠?qū)崿F(xiàn)雜波距離依賴(lài)性的自適應(yīng)補(bǔ)償,在存在陣元誤差時(shí)的雜波抑制性能同樣較為穩(wěn)定.
[Abstract]:The problem of aperture loss and prior information mismatch based on the conventional registration compensation method results in clutter distance dependence and compensation performance degradation. In order to solve the above problems, sparse restoration algorithm is introduced into clutter distance dependence compensation, and the preprocessing process of echo data of each distance unit in the conventional registration-based compensation method is improved. A robust distance registration compensation method-SRBC method based on sparse restoration is proposed. Compared with the conventional registration-based compensation method, this method does not need sub-aperture smoothing and does not depend on prior knowledge. The super-resolution space-time spectrum of clutter is obtained directly by sparse restoration, and the transition covariance matrix is obtained by calculating the matrix of transition covariance. Then the clutter covariance matrix is reconstructed by Capon spectrum. Simulation results show that the SRBC method is not affected by prior information mismatch. It can not only compensate clutter distance dependence adaptively, but also stabilize clutter suppression performance in the presence of element errors.
